At Mom and Bop, we offer a warm and inviting atmosphere that makes you feel like you're dining with family. Our intimate setting is perfect for solo diners or groups looking for a cozy spot to enjoy delicious Korean cuisine. Our menu features a range of signature dishes, including kimchi fried rice, glass noodles, beef and chicken bimbimpap, and vegan bibimbap, all made with big flavors at reasonable prices. With our no-contact delivery, takeout, and dine-in options, you can enjoy your meal whenever and wherever you want. We're proud to be a wheelchair accessible restaurant, ensuring that everyone feels welcome. Come taste the real deal of Korean food in Santa Monica!

Mom and Bop is a small, cozy Korean restaurant known for its authentic, homestyle food and friendly service. The bibimbap and kimchi stew are highly recommended. It's a popular spot, especially for takeout, near Santa Monica College.

Stumbled upon this Korean place during a business trip to LA. As a frequent visitor to Korea and Korean food enthusiast, I was very impressed with the taste and quality of their food. Looking around me I saw what appeared to be authentic Korean staples (BiBimBap, Japchae) being enjoyed by other patrons, mostly local college students. I ordered KimChi stew (KimchiJigae) which was excellent! 5-stars for the food. The prices were fair. My one Star reduction was for the restaurant operations. Despite signs saying Order Here at the counter, you must order online or at a kiosk that I found rather clunky and required constant multiple key-presses to work. The kiosk was out of paper and unable to print a receipt. I found the tables and seating to be rather dirty and stained. Yes, there are signs around asking you to clean up after yourself, which I was happy to do, but eating a slurpy soup is bound to splatter all over, no matter how careful you are. I wiped up after myself with the few paper napkins given, but the table was stained nonetheless, by myself and previous dinners. My final regret was the wide use of single-use plastics. The trash was overflowing with plastic cutlery and bowels....all going to the trash dump. I found this unusual, as most other Korean "fast food" places I've experienced, either use reusable metal cutlery and plastic bowls, or modern compostable bowls and sustainable wooden cutlery (for which I'd be willing to pay a little more for). Finally, I was shocked they didn't offer any tea. It wasn't on the Online Menu and I asked at the counter. In summary. Excellent food. Despite the low-market location and fast-casual clientele, I was surprised at the general lack of cleanliness and use of plastic everything.
